Q1.Describe Mrs. Fields Cookies in terms of its complexity, formalization and centralization?

ANSWER:

Complexity refers to degree of differentiation that exists within an organization. This


differentiation can either be horizontal, vertical or even spatial.

HORIZONTAL DIFFERENITATION:
In this scenario store employees are young and inexperienced.
There is no specialization and departmentalization in the organization because most of the task
are performed by the computer information systems.

VERTICAL DIFFERCITATION:
this is a vertical differentiation because it is mentioned in the case
that manager’s hierarchy of the company feels almost flat to store managers, while the tight
management controls are managed.

SPATIAL DIFFERENTIATION:
there is spatial differentiation in the organization because since
Mrs. Field’s cookies have nearly five hundred stores in thirty seven states. So in order to manage
this widely dispersed operation computer information systems have been installed.

CENTERALIZATION:
there is high centralization in the organization because each store
manager after consulting the day planner program makes decision and that day planner is
designed according to the needs of the business. The system set outs the goals, how many
customers will be needed each hour, how much the cookie mixture is to be made etc and passes
these decision to the store managers.

FORMALIZATION:
formalization would tend to be high because most of the
companies nearly 4500 stores employees are young and inexperienced, and know little about the
cookie business so to guide and lead these inexperienced store employees the company had to
design a formalize system and it is witnessed from the case where they have mentioned that each
store manager begins his/her day by calling up the day planner program on the store computer.
The system use to inform them that how many customer will be needed each hour and how much
each customer will need to purchase.

Q3.Are computer information systems parts of an organizations technology? Discuss.

ANSWER:

Organization technology is basically the tools, techniques and actions that are used transform
the organization’s inputs into outputs. Computer information systems are playing the key role
and are responsible for making the organization’s decisions and provide valuable information to
managers they have no link with production process. Since the individual store computer are
linked to park city, which enable randy to access to how things are going it clearly shows that
information systems are part of an organization’s technology.

Q5.What negative store level repercussion might result from this system?

ANSWER:

Negative store level repercussions that might result from this system are as follows:

• It may lead to frustration because of repetition of task.

• Operations might stop due to the breakdown in system because they are totally dependent
on their system.

• Store people did not have any power to make decision.
